Procedure for Trademark Registration Vietnam

The procedure for trademark registration Vietnam is as follows:

Vietnam trademark search

This is the stage where the applicant needs to check the availability of the trademark that will get registered to ensure that there are no identical or similar trademarks registered to filed in.

Filing of an Application

The applicant can submit the application to the Intellectual Property Office of Vietnam (IPVN) either in person, by mail, or online. For online submission, the applicant must have a digital certificate, digital signature, and an approved registered account with IPVN. All required documents and the prescribed fees must be attached, and upon submission, an application number will be issued for trademark registration in Vietnam.

Vietnam National Office of Intellectual Property (NOIP)

Within one month of filing for trademark registration in Vietnam, the Vietnam National Office of Intellectual Property (NOIP) will review the application. If the applicant meets all legal requirements, NOIP will issue a decision accepting the trademark application. Otherwise, NOIP will issue a notification of the required correction, and the applicant has to respond within two months from the issuing date.

Publication of Vietnam Trademark Application on IP Gazette

Within two months of formally accepting the trademark registration, NOIP shall publish the application for Trademark Registration Vietnam for any possible opposition on Vietnam IP Gazette.

Substantive Examination of Trademark in Vietnam

The Vietnam National Office of Intellectual Property (NOIP) will conduct a substantive examination of the trademark application within 9-12 months (or longer) from the publication date. If approved, the trademark registration certificate will be issued within 1-2 months. However, if the application is refused, the applicant must respond within three months.

Timeline for Trademark Registration in Vietnam

The timeline for trademark registration in Vietnam is as follows:

  • Submit trademark application- Two to three days
  • Formality Examination of the Trademark Registration Application Vietnam – one month
  • Publication of Trademark Application- Two months
  • Substantive Examination of Application- Nine months
  • Granting the Trademark Registration certificate- Two to Three months

When a Trademark Renewal Request must be Filed in Vietnam?

A trademark registration certificate in Vietnam is valid for 10 years from the filing date and can be renewed indefinitely. The renewal request must be submitted to IP Vietnam within six months before the expiration date. A six-month grace period is available after expiration, but a late renewal incurs a surcharge of 10% of the normal renewal fee (USD 6) per class for each delayed month.

Requirements for Trademark Registration in Vietnam

Below is the list of general requirements for trademark registration in Vietnam-

  • Each application can only obtain a single protection title in Vietnam
  • All documentation must be in Vietnamese
  • All documents must be in the form of a portrait
  • A pre-designed form must be used
  • The page numbers of the trademark documents must be in Arabic
  • All documents must be typewritten or printed with non-fading ink to Vietnamese standards
  • The application for a trademark registration Vietnam may be accompanied by a supporting document, i.e., an electronic data carrier (USD, CD) containing part of all of its content.

Reasons to Refuse Trademark Registration in Vietnam

The list of reasons to refuse trademark registration in Vietnam is as follows:

  1. Trademark objection for lack of distinctive character

A trademark objection for lack of distinctive character arises when it fails to perform its function of differentiating the origin of foods and goods offered by different entities. No arguments are valid when the marks are prohibited by Vietnamese laws. On the other hand, if the trademark is not prohibited, then the applicant must provide a valid argument for the same.

 

  1. Trademark objection due to similarity with other trademarks

A trademark objection due to similarity with other trademarks refers to a condition where the trademark is refused due to its similarity with other trademarks. In this case, the applicant needs to prove that the objected trademark is dissimilar to the cited trademark(s) and does not create any likelihood of confusion.

The validity of the Vietnam trademark registration certificate is for ten years from the filing date. It can be renewed unlimited times once it has expired.

Vietnam follows a first-to-file system for trademark registration, granting the certificate to the applicant with the earliest filing date. If multiple applications meet the same requirements and have the same filing date, the trademark is awarded to a single applicant only if all agree.
